Explore how generative AI can revolutionise data management practices for businesses.

Generative AI, a beacon of technological innovation, has been making waves, with its market on track to exceed $22 billion by 2025. This technology redefines the data handling and interpretation landscape, a crucial shift in an era where information holds immense value. Businesses increasingly rely on generative AI for efficient data management solutions. According to a recent survey by Andreessen Horowitz, the leading enterprise applications of GenAI include text summarisation and knowledge management, exemplified by tools like internal chatbots. This underscores the transformative potential of generative AI in revolutionising data management practices.

Revolutionising information management

Incorporating generative AI into knowledge bases allows companies to efficiently transform and update extensive information repositories, ensuring access to the latest data. This technology autonomously generates new content, filling gaps and addressing user questions with detailed FAQs, guides, and articles, adapting to evolving user needs. Tools powered by generative AI can even automate the production of video tutorials, streamlining the information search and understanding process for both employees and consumers. Duolingo, an example of this in action, leverages generative AI to help workers navigate organisational knowledge, exemplifying how such innovations enhance information management and affirm a company’s reputation as a knowledgeable, responsive industry leader.

Optimising internal wikis

Generative AI offers a powerful solution for the challenges of maintaining up-to-date, coherent internal wikis, thereby enhancing knowledge accessibility and operational efficiency. This technology significantly lightens the manual workload by automating the identification and correction of content gaps or outdated information. It improves content structure for easier categorisation and navigation while ensuring consistency in format and tone across entries. The adoption of generative AI transforms internal wikis into dynamic, evolving platforms that support collaborative knowledge sharing, driving efficiency and innovation within businesses.

Enhancing customer support

AI-generated product documentation marks a significant leap forward in improving customer support and the user experience. By creating clear, concise, and customised documentation, businesses can resolve customer queries more effectively, enhancing satisfaction and reducing the burden on support teams. This technology speeds up problem resolution and leverages user feedback to refine documentation, continually ensuring it remains relevant and valuable. Such a proactive stance enriches the user experience, strengthens brand loyalty, and fosters trust, establishing AI-generated documentation as a crucial asset in elevating customer service. Optimising data management

To fully utilise generative AI in data management, businesses must ensure data quality, select the right AI tools tailored to their needs, possibly with the help of AI specialists, and focus on seamless integration into existing operations. The rapidly growing GenAI landscape, highlighted by a Dealroom report listing over 1,200 companies, offers a wealth of tools like Tovie AI’s Data Agent, supporting diverse data formats and sources. Successful implementation hinges on iterative training, user adoption, and continuous updates to meet business needs. By adhering to these practices, companies can leverage generative AI to transform data into a strategic asset, enhancing operations and spurring innovation for a competitive advantage in the industry.
